Who Should Use Which

Indie Developer / Solo Hacker

Neither tool targets solo developers. AI Emaily edges out for individuals drowning in email across multiple accountsβ€”it handles the triage and drafting grunt work with zero setup overhead. Ogment AI's 1,000+ connectors are wasted on a single user without a team Slack workspace.

Startup Team (5-20 Engineers)

Ogment AI wins here. The one-click Slack install means the entire team is AI-enabled instantly without retraining workflows. Proactive automation that spots repetitive patterns and turns them into hands-free tasks directly reduces the overhead of growing a startup's operational cadence.

Enterprise (100+ Engineers)

Ogment AI again. SOC 2 compliance, usage analytics, and per-user credit controls address enterprise procurement requirements. AI Emaily lacks the team-wide visibility and governance controls that enterprise IT teams demand.

Ogment AI operates on a credit system where each automation consumes credits based on complexity and tool connectors used. Teams report spending roughly $20-$50 per user monthly at moderate automation volumes. AI Emaily pricing centers on email volume processed, with users indicating costs scale predictably with inbox size.

Both platforms avoid requiring credit cards for initial access, lowering barrier to entry. Ogment AI's credit-based model benefits teams with irregular automation needs, while AI Emaily's email-centric pricing suits high-volume email operators.

If budget is the main constraint, pick Ogment AI because the credit-based model lets teams control spend by limiting automation volume, whereas AI Emaily costs tied to email volume can escalate faster for heavy inbox users.

Section 6: Switching Considerations

Migrating between platforms involves data portability, workflow reconstruction, and cost recalibration.

Prompt compatibility differs significantly. Ogment AI stores automations as configurable workflows tied to its connector ecosystem. AI Emaily focuses on email-specific actions. Switching from AI Emaily to Ogment AI requires rebuilding email workflows within a broader automation context. The reverse migration strips away cross-tool automations, retaining only email actions.

API access exists for both but uses different paradigms. Ogment AI exposes team-level controls and connector management. AI Emaily's API centers on email operations. Integration complexity depends on existing tool stacks; teams heavily invested in Slack workflows face higher switching costs to AI Emaily, while email-centric operations minimize migration effort.

Cost impact varies by usage patterns. Teams with high email volume may find AI Emaily's pricing scales favorably, while automation-heavy teams benefit from Ogment AI's predictable credit consumption. Neither platform charges explicit migration fees, but indirect costs include productivity loss during transition and potential need for workflow redesign.

The switch is worth it if your primary bottleneck shifts from email management to cross-tool automation, or vice versa, justifying the reconstruction of existing workflows and associated learning curve.
